Minnesota gives up an average of 24 pts per game, They average scoring 21. They average giving up 153 yds a game on the ground. Now in Big only stats they give up 29 pts a game which ranks 9th in the league, They rank 9th in rushing defense giving up 154 yds per game.. No disrespect to Minnesota but they are not an elite defense in any realm. They can be run on.
So to answer your question, I think Iowa will be able to move the ball on them.
